What Is the Mexico Digital Nomad Visa 2025?
The Digital Nomad Visa (technically issued under Mexico’s Temporary Resident Visa category) allows foreign remote workers to live and work remotely in Mexico for up to four years.
It’s perfect for:
- Freelancers or self-employed professionals
- Remote employees working for international companies
- Entrepreneurs managing online businesses
Unlike tourist visas (valid for only 180 days), this visa provides long-term stability and eligibility for future residency.

Eligibility Criteria (2025 Updated)
Applicants must prove they can work remotely and sustain themselves financially.

Minimum income requirements (2025):
- Monthly income: Around $3,100 USD (from remote work, salary, or freelancing)
- Bank balance alternative: Savings of at least $52,000 USD in the past 12 months
Additional eligibility:
- Valid passport (6+ months validity)
- Remote employment contract or business ownership proof
- Clean criminal record
- Health insurance coverage valid in Mexico
Required Documents Checklist
To apply for the Mexico Digital Nomad Visa, prepare the following:
- Visa application form (completed & signed)
- Valid passport and photocopy
- Recent passport-size photo (front-facing, color, white background)
- Proof of remote employment or freelance contracts
- Recent bank statements or proof of monthly income
- Proof of health insurance
- Visa fee payment receipt (~$53 USD at consulates)
Mexico Digital Nomad Visa 2025 Step-by-Step Application Process

Step 1: Book an Appointment at a Mexican Consulate
Locate your nearest Mexican consulate and schedule your appointment online.
Step 2: Submit Application & Attend Interview
Bring all documents and attend an in-person interview. Be ready to explain your remote work arrangement.
Step 3: Temporary Visa Issuance
If approved, you’ll receive a 180-day entry visa sticker on your passport.
Step 4: Travel to Mexico & Finalize Residency Card
Within 30 days of entering Mexico, visit an INM (Instituto Nacional de Migración) office to exchange your sticker for a Temporary Resident Card.
Costs & Processing Time for Mexico Digital Nomad Visa 2025

Stage | Estimated Cost (USD) | Processing Time |
---|
Consulate application | $53 | 1–3 weeks |
Resident card issuance | $240–$350 | 10–20 days |
Renewal (per year) | $200–$300 | 10–15 days |
Tip: Budget at least $600–$800 total for visa and documentation expenses.

Taxes for Mexico Digital Nomads Visa 2025 Update
If you’re working for a foreign company and your income is deposited abroad, you may not be taxed in Mexico — but this depends on your stay duration and tax residency.
Tip: Consult a tax professional familiar with Mexico’s SAT authority or refer to OECD Tax Residency Guidelines for clarification.
Renewal & Transition to Permanent Residency
After four consecutive years under the Temporary Resident Visa, you can apply for Permanent Residency in Mexico.
Benefits:
- No income proof required afterward
- Indefinite stay rights
- Option to apply for Mexican citizenship later
Common Mistakes to Avoid

Submitting outdated financial proof
Ignoring translation requirements for non-Spanish documents
Missing the 30-day deadline after entering Mexico
Not having international health insurance
FAQs: Mexico Digital Nomad Visa 2025
Q1. Can I work for a Mexican company under this visa?
No, you can only work for foreign companies or clients while living in Mexico.
Q2. How long can I stay in Mexico with this visa?
Up to four years, renewable annually.
Q3. Can my family join me?
Yes, dependents can be added with additional income proof.
Q4. What happens if I change jobs or clients?
You must maintain your income threshold, but you can change remote employers freely.
